Top 10 Richest Cricketers in the World 2025: Legends Who Turned Cricket into Gold

Cricket isn’t just a sport; it’s a lucrative career path for those who excel. Over the years, many cricketers have transformed their on-field success into substantial wealth through endorsements, business ventures, and smart investments. As of 2025, let’s delve into the lives of the top 10 richest cricketers who have not only dominated the pitch but also the financial charts.

1. Sachin Tendulkar – The Master Blaster ($170 Million)

Sachin Tendulkar, revered as the “God of Cricket,” tops the list with an estimated net worth of $170 million. His illustrious career, spanning over two decades, saw him break numerous records, including being the first to score 100 international centuries. Post-retirement, Tendulkar ventured into various businesses, including co-owning the Kerala Blasters FC in the Indian Super League and launching his own line of sports equipment. His endorsements with brands like Coca-Cola, Adidas, and BMW have significantly contributed to his wealth. 

2. MS Dhoni –  Richest Captain Cool ($125 Million)

Mahendra Singh Dhoni, known for his calm demeanor and sharp cricketing acumen, has a net worth of approximately $125 million. Under his captaincy, India clinched the 2007 T20 World Cup, 2011 ODI World Cup, and the 2013 Champions Trophy. Beyond cricket, Dhoni has invested in various ventures, including a chain of gyms and a production house. His endorsements with brands like Reebok, Pepsi, and Sony have further bolstered his earnings.

3. Virat Kohli – The Modern Maestro ($122 Million)

Virat Kohli, one of the most consistent performers in modern cricket, boasts a net worth of $122 million. His aggressive batting style and leadership qualities have made him a favorite among fans and brands alike. Kohli’s endorsements include giants like Audi, Puma, and MRF. He also co-owns the fashion brand WROGN and has invested in various fitness ventures, reflecting his commitment to a healthy lifestyle. 

4. Ricky Ponting – The Australian Legend ($100 Million

Ricky Ponting, one of Australia’s most successful captains, has an estimated net worth of $100 million. Leading Australia to two consecutive World Cup victories in 2003 and 2007, Ponting’s on-field success translated into lucrative commentary roles and coaching assignments post-retirement. He also ventured into the wine business with his label, Ponting Wines, showcasing his entrepreneurial spirit. 

5. Jacques Kallis – The South African All-Rounder ($70 Million)

Jacques Kallis, renowned for his prowess both with the bat and ball, has a net worth of around $70 million. His consistency made him a mainstay in the South African team for years. Post-retirement, Kallis took up coaching roles and became a sought-after mentor in various T20 leagues, further enhancing his earnings. 

6. Brian Lara – The Caribbean King ($60 Million)

Brian Lara, with his elegant batting style, has a net worth of approximately $60 million. Holding the record for the highest individual score in a Test match (400 not out), Lara’s cricketing achievements are legendary. His endorsements, coupled with roles as a cricket commentator and analyst, have contributed to his substantial wealth. 

7. Shane Warne – The Spin Wizard ($50 Million)

Shane Warne, one of the greatest leg-spinners in cricket history, amassed a net worth of $50 million. His charismatic personality made him a favorite among brands and media houses. Warne’s ventures included a clothing line and a poker company, showcasing his diverse interests. His untimely demise in 2022 was a significant loss to the cricketing world.

8. Virender Sehwag – The Nawab of Najafgarh Cricketer ($42 Million)

Virender Sehwag, known for his aggressive batting, has a net worth of $42 million. His fearless approach redefined opening batting in Test cricket. Post-retirement, Sehwag became a popular cricket commentator and launched the Sehwag International School, emphasizing his commitment to education and sports. 

9. Yuvraj Singh – The Comeback King ($40 Million)

Yuvraj Singh, celebrated for his six sixes in an over during the 2007 T20 World Cup, has a net worth of $40 million. His battle with cancer and subsequent return to international cricket inspired many. Yuvraj’s foundation, YouWeCan, supports cancer patients and survivors. His brand endorsements and cricketing achievements have significantly contributed to his wealth.

10. Chris Gayle – The Universe Boss ($30 Million)

Chris Gayle, with his flamboyant style and powerful hitting, has a net worth of $30 million. A T20 specialist, Gayle’s performances in leagues worldwide have made him a global cricketing icon. His ventures include a music label and a clothing line, reflecting his vibrant personality.

Conclusion: Beyond the Boundary

These cricketers have demonstrated that success on the field can translate into substantial wealth off it. Through endorsements, business ventures, and personal brands, they’ve built empires that extend beyond cricket. Their journeys inspire aspiring cricketers to dream big, both on and off the pitch.
